Cost of Living Comparison Between Glarus and Geneva Cost of Living Comparison Between Glarus and Geneva

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$3,410 per month in Glarus vs $4,177 in Geneva, rent included.

A couple spends around $5,117 per month in Glarus vs $6,255 in Geneva, rent included.

A family of three spends $6,823 per month in Glarus vs $8,333 in Geneva, rent included.

Glarus is about 18% cheaper than Geneva,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

Both Glarus and Geneva sit above the global median – Glarus by 148%, Geneva by 204%.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$1,762 in Glarus versus $2,828 in Geneva.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$122 in Glarus versus $133 in Geneva.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$451 vs $605 – making Glarus the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
